Xiaomi releases MiMo‑V2‑Flash model with faster response than DeepSeek
Xiaomi has officially launched and open‑sourced its new foundational language model, MiMo‑V2‑Flash. The model emphasizes high efficiency and ultra‑fast performance, excelling in reasoning, code generation, and agent‑based applications. It can also serve as a general AI assistant for everyday tasks.
Early user testing shows that MiMo‑V2‑Flash delivers response speeds faster than other models such as Doubao, DeepSeek, and Yuanbao. Many users reported being surprised by the speed difference, especially in question‑answering scenarios.
From a technical standpoint, MiMo‑V2‑Flash has a total of 309 billion parameters, with 15 billion active parameters. Benchmark results place it among the top tier of current open‑source large models. Both the model weights and inference code are fully open‑sourced under the MIT license.
In terms of cost, Xiaomi has priced the API at $0.10 (≈¥0.73) per million input tokens and $0.30 (≈¥2.19) per million output tokens. For now, the company is offering limited free access to encourage adoption.
